Overview of Seneca College Academic Calendar

The academic calendar at Seneca College serves as a vital roadmap for students, faculty, and staff navigating the rhythm of higher education in Toronto, Ontario. As one of Canada's leading polytechnic institutions, Seneca structures its year around a semester system that balances intensive learning with essential breaks, fostering both academic excellence and personal well-being. This calendar outlines key periods for instruction, assessments, holidays, and administrative milestones, ensuring everyone can align their commitments effectively.

Historically, Seneca's calendar has evolved to reflect the diverse needs of its commuter student body, many of whom juggle part-time jobs, family responsibilities, and full course loads. Unlike traditional universities with longer terms, Seneca's semesters are designed for practical, career-focused programs in fields like business, technology, health, and arts. This approach emphasizes hands-on learning, with built-in flexibility for applied projects and co-op placements. The calendar also incorporates Canadian statutory holidays, such as Labour Day and Thanksgiving, providing opportunities for rest and cultural observance.

For international students, who make up a significant portion of Seneca's enrollment, the calendar aligns with global mobility patterns, offering clear timelines for visa renewals and orientation sessions. Parents and prospective applicants often use it to coordinate family travel or assess program fit. Faculty and staff benefit from structured deadlines for grading, meetings, and professional development, promoting a collaborative environment.

Comparing Seneca to other Ontario colleges, its calendar stands out for its emphasis on continuous intake options in select programs, allowing mid-year starts that cater to working professionals. This flexibility impacts student success rates, as evidenced by high completion statistics in vocational streams. 🗂️What is the structure of Seneca College terms?

Terms are fall (Sept-Dec), winter (Jan-Apr), summer (May-Aug), with 15-week semesters. Flexible for part-time. Includes reading weeks. Compares to universities by being career-focused. Contrast with elites. Plan via ratings: professor insights.
